It turns out that DODMALLOC was broken when I reorganized busybox.h
header file usage before the 0.49 release. To fix it, I had to move the '#include "busybox.h"' to the end of the list of #include files. -Erik git-svn-id: svn://busybox.net/trunk/busybox@1864 69ca8d6d-28ef-0310-b511-8ec308f3f277
